SUMMARY:SXSW Early Learning Summit
DESCRIPTION:While meeting the needs of our youngest children is proven to open endless opportunities to realize human potential for health\, happiness\, and a lifetime of making meaningful contributions\, the early childhood system is too fragmented and under resourced to deliver innovation at scale. We have the science that shows the potential for building and improving kids’ lives\, and we have learning methods and community-based health models that are proving successful\, for a few\, but we struggle to imagine how things could be different\, very different for many.\n\nIn the past\, siloed approaches\, cultural barriers\, and generational blind spots have limited progress. Deeper understanding\, fresh voices\, new relationships\, and entrepreneurial energy is needed to cast a vision for the 30-year future for young children in America.  A committed group of creative leaders is needed to bring the vision to life and to sustain it.\n\nDon’t miss the Play\, Technology and the Young Child panel featuring Michael Levine\, which will explore how innovations in technology are changing the way children learn and play.\n\nhttp://www.earlylearningsummit.com

SUMMARY:Tap\, Click\, Read: EdWeb Webinar
DESCRIPTION:With young children gaining access to a dizzying array of games\, videos\, and other digital media\, will they ever learn to read? The answer is yes—if they are surrounded by adults who know how to help and if they are introduced to media designed to promote literacy\, instead of undermining it. In this webinar\, Michael Levine and Lisa Guernsey\, authors of Tap\, Click\, Read: Growing Readers in a World of Screens\, will show how educators and parents can help children grow into strong\, passionate readers who are skilled at using media and technology of all kinds—print\, digital\, and everything in between.\n\nOn Tuesday\, March 29 from 4-5pm ET\, join Michael Levine and Lisa Guernsey for a free webinar presented by EdWeb and Common Sense Education to learn about tools and strategies for supporting literacy for all. Early childhood educators including teachers\, librarian/media specialists\, technology specialists\, literacy coaches\, curriculum specialists\, and parents all will benefit from this live\, interactive session.
